THIS traditional six-bedroomed cottage in Dunquin, Dingle, which is now on the market with Sherry FitzGerald O’Connell, was one of seven or eight built for the Blasket islanders by Kerry County Council in the early 1950s.

Selling agent Peter Fenton says the current owner lived in the cottage while renting out a newer three-bed extension next door.

“This entire property can be sold as one full unit, which would make it nine-bedroomed or the pair of semi-detached houses can be bought separately,” explains Mr Fenton.
